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lamphey to Appledore (Kent) start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lamphey to Appledore (Kent) start from £127.30 one way, or £128.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lamphey to Appledore (Kent) are available for £184.50 one way, or £369.00 return

Lamphey Station Details & Facilities

While simplistic in its offerings, Lamphey Train Station operates with ease and convenience. For those purchasing tickets, it's important to note that there is no ticket office, and unfortunately, ticket machines and collection points are absent. Instead, tickets should be purchased and collected via online platforms ahead of your journey. An induction loop is available for those with hearing aids, ensuring accessibility in communication. While the station lacks typical amenities like a waiting room, toilets, and refreshment facilities, rest assured there are seating areas available to await your train. Wheelchair users will find some step-free access, though it's limited, so plan accordingly.

Transport Links to and from Lamphey Station

Traveling onward from Lamphey is straightforward, thanks to a variety of options. For rail enthusiasts who may face disruptions, a replacement bus service operates from a nearby bus stop on the A4139, close to the church. While taxis aren't available directly from the station, a rank can be found over 300 yards away at the Lamphey Hotel. Some bus services complement the station, yet timetables vary, so checking ahead is advised. While cycle hire isn't available directly from the station, it's feasible to explore the local area on two wheels by arranging hire services before arrival.

Station Facilities and Amenities

At Appledore (Kent) train station, you'll find a variety of facilities to accommodate your travel needs. While there isn't a ticket office, it has ticket machines available, allowing you to purchase or collect tickets. Tickets bought online can also be collected using these machines. They are designed with accessibility in mind and can accommodate discounts from a Disabled Persons Railcard.

For those needing assistance, help points are conveniently positioned around the station, providing information and direct lines to support services. Additionally, the station is equipped with screens that show departure information and make announcements to keep passengers updated.

Accessibility is partially covered, with step-free access to platform 1 (heading towards Ashford International) and a short path with a gentle ramp leading to platform 2 (heading towards Hastings). Moreover, the station lacks some amenities such as accessible toilets and dedicated waiting rooms, but there is a sheltered seating area on the platform where you can find some respite while waiting for your train.

Parking is managed by APCOA Parking UK and offers free parking with a limited number of spaces, including one dedicated accessible space. Regrettably, the station doesn’t have ref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, so it's advisable to plan ahead if you need any of these amenities.
